#ac1438 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ac1438 is composed of 67.5% red, 7.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.4%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 345.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ac1438 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2870 with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#ac1438 color description : Dark red.

#ac1438 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ac1438 has RGB values of R:172, G:20,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.67,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11277368.

Shades and Tints of #ac1438

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0205 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ac1438

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625e5f is the less saturated color, while #bb0530 is the most saturated one.
